COLT, LONDON
A COMPOSED CASED PAIR OF .41 RIMFIRE VEST-PISTOLS, MODEL 'No3 THUER PATENT DERRINGERS', serial no's. 3436 & none visible
circa 1880, both pistols in identical finish with blued 2 1/2in. swing sideways barrels marked on the tops 'COLT', nickel-plated frames and smooth rosewood birdshead grips, both pistols with London proofs and retaining the majority of their finish in all areas; TOGETHER WITH an English market oak case expertly re-lined in red baize, compartmented in the English manner and containing the pistols together with a period oil-bottle and possibly original brass cleaning rod, the lid with later label for 'S. HAMMOND, 2 JEWRY STREET, WINCHESTER'.
Other Notes: For a similar composed cased pair of pistols see 'The Collecting of Derringers' by Eberhart, serial no's 38250 & 39046, retailed by H. Watson & Son
